Comedy Origins
Nick Youssef's journey into comedy began with a fascination for stand-up, inspired by comedians like Norm MacDonald and David Tell. At 16, he expressed his desire to pursue comedy, much to the confusion of his family, who couldn't fathom it as a career 1. His first exposure to performing came through a comedy class at Glendale Community College, where he learned the basics of stage presence and joke delivery 1. Despite initial setbacks, such as a harsh critique at his first showcase, Nick remained undeterred, finding a sense of self and grounding in comedy 2.
Comedy Store
Nick's path at the Comedy Store was marked by perseverance and growth. Starting as a phone operator, he gradually worked his way up, eventually earning the coveted status of a paid regular 3. His journey was not without challenges, including the nerve-wracking experience of showcasing for Mitzi Shore, the club's legendary owner 4. Despite the pressure, Nick's talent shone through, and he was eventually recognized as a paid regular, a significant milestone in his comedy career 5.
Comedic Influences
Influenced by a diverse group of comedians, Nick Youssef's style evolved to be conversational and introspective. He was inspired by the alt-comedy scene, meeting influential figures like Maria Bamford and Chris Hardwick, which shaped his comedic voice 6. His interactions with other comedians at the Comedy Store further honed his craft, as he navigated the club's dynamics and sought approval from its formidable gatekeeper, Mitzi Shore 7. Nick's journey reflects a blend of personal growth and professional development, driven by his passion for comedy and the influence of his peers 8.
